.htaccess 重写迁移的 Wordpress 网站

.htaccess 重写迁移的 Wordpress 网站

我已将我的 Wordpress 从一个域移动到另一个域,并且我想使用 .htaccess 301 重定向将旧域上的帖子重定向到新域上的帖子。

我的网站托管商建议我尝试以下操作:

 Options +FollowSymlinks
 RewriteEngine On
 RewriteCond %{HTTP_HOST} ^(www\.)?steve\.doig\.com\.au/wordpress/$ [NC]
 RewriteRule ^(.*)$ http://www.superlogical.net/$1 [R=301,L]

这仅适用于 /wordpress 文件夹,但不适用于任何类别页面或帖子。

这里有什么问题?

答案1

此行RewriteCond %{HTTP_HOST} ^(www\.)?steve\.doig\.com\.au/wordpress/$ [NC]设置了重写过程的条件。基本上,它只适用于以 结尾的 URL /wordpress/。尝试注释该行(如果您只运行了 Wordpress 安装,它将重定向所有内容)。

相关内容